Types of Gadget Tools
Productivity gadgets can be categorized into three main types: software, hardware, and accessories. Each category offers unique features and benefits that cater to different aspects of productivity.
- Software: This includes applications designed for project management, time tracking, and communication. Examples include Trello, Asana, and Slack.
- Hardware: Physical devices like computers, ergonomic keyboards, and monitors that enhance the working environment and user comfort.
- Accessories: Complementary tools such as planners, styluses, and charging stations that support the primary gadgets in use.

Popular Software Tools for Productivity
A variety of software tools are available to enhance productivity, each with specific functionalities designed to improve workflow efficiency. Notable examples include:
- Trello: A visual project management tool that helps teams organize tasks using boards and lists.
- Asana: Task management software that aids in tracking project progress and assigning responsibilities.
- Slack: A communication platform that facilitates real-time messaging and file sharing among team members.

Challenges and Solutions
Adopting new productivity gadgets often brings challenges that users must navigate. Common hurdles include the learning curve associated with new software and resistance to change.
- Learning New Software: Users may struggle to adapt to unfamiliar interfaces.
- Integration Issues: Some tools may not seamlessly work together.
- Resistance to Change: Long-standing habits can hinder the adoption of new tools.
To overcome these challenges, consider the following strategies:
Challenge | Proposed Solution |
---|---|
Learning Curve | Provide training sessions and tutorials. |
Integration Issues | Choose tools with compatible features and APIs. |
Resistance to Change | Highlight the benefits and improvements in efficiency. |
